AI-Driven Stakeholder Analysis and Engagement
One of the most significant advancements in 2025 was the utilization of AI for comprehensive stakeholder analysis. AI algorithms can now process vast amounts of data to identify key influencers, predict potential conflicts, and suggest optimal engagement strategies. This capability has proven invaluable in navigating the intricate web of stakeholders typical in energy projects, ranging from local communities to government regulators and environmental groups.
Predictive Project Management
AI’s predictive capabilities have transformed the planning and execution of energy projects. By analyzing historical data and current trends, AI systems can forecast potential delays, resource shortages, and budget overruns with remarkable accuracy. This foresight enables project managers to take proactive measures, significantly reducing the risk of project failure.
Enhanced Resource Allocation
In 2025, AI-powered resource allocation emerged as a game-changer for energy projects. These systems can optimize the distribution of labor, materials, and equipment across multiple project sites, considering factors such as weather conditions, supply chain disruptions, and local regulations. This level of optimization has resulted in substantial cost savings and improved project timelines.
Real-Time Decision Support
AI-driven decision support systems have become indispensable for project managers navigating the complexities of multi-stakeholder energy initiatives. These systems can process real-time data from various sources, providing managers with actionable insights and recommendations. This capability has proven particularly valuable in crisis management scenarios, facilitating rapid and informed decision-making.
Automated Reporting and Communication
Effective communication is crucial in multi-stakeholder projects, and AI has significantly streamlined this process. Automated reporting systems can generate customized updates for different stakeholder groups, ensuring that all parties receive relevant information in a timely manner. This has greatly enhanced transparency and trust among stakeholders.
AI in Sustainability and Compliance
As sustainability becomes increasingly central to energy projects, AI has played a vital role in ensuring compliance with environmental regulations and stakeholder expectations. AI systems can monitor and predict environmental impacts, suggest mitigation strategies, and track progress towards sustainability goals.
Challenges and Ethical Considerations
While the benefits of AI in project management are evident, 2025 also brought increased focus on the ethical implications of AI use. Issues such as data privacy, algorithmic bias, and the potential for AI to replace human jobs have become significant considerations for project managers. Successful projects have implemented robust governance frameworks to address these concerns and ensure responsible AI use.
The Human-AI Collaboration
Perhaps the most important lesson from 2025 is that AI is most effective when used to augment human capabilities rather than replace them. Successful project managers have learned to leverage AI for data-driven insights while relying on human judgment for strategic decision-making and stakeholder relationship management.
